2005-12-31 | CVE-2005-4701 | Unspecified vulnerability in Process File System (procfs) in Sun Solaris 10 allows local users to obtain sensitive information such as process working directories via unknown attack vectors, possibly pwdx. | Solaris | N/A | ||
2005-12-09 | CVE-2005-4133 | Sun Update Connection in Sun Solaris 10, when configured to use a web proxy, allows local users to obtain the proxy authentication password via (1) an unspecified vector and (2) proxy log files. | Solaris | N/A | ||
2005-11-23 | CVE-2005-3781 | Unspecified vulnerability in in.named in Solaris 9 allows attackers to cause a denial of service via unknown manipulations that cause in.named to "make unnecessary queries." | Solaris, Sunos | N/A | ||
2005-11-18 | CVE-2005-3674 | The Internet Key Exchange version 1 (IKEv1) implementation in the libike library in Sun Solaris 9 and 10 all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(in.iked crash) via certain crafted IKE packets, as demonstrated by the PROTOS ISAKMP Test Suite for IKEv1. NOTE: due to the lack of details in the advisory, it is unclear which of CVE-2005-3666, CVE-2005-3667, and/or CVE-2005-3668 this issue applies to. | Solaris | N/A | ||
2005-11-01 | CVE-2005-3398 | The default configuration of the web server for the Solaris Management Console (SMC) in Solaris 8, 9, and 10 enables the HTTP TRACE method, which could allow remote attackers to obtain sensitive information such as cookies and authentication data from HTTP headers. | Solaris, Sunos | N/A | ||
2005-10-17 | CVE-2005-3250 | Unknown vulnerability in Solaris 10 allows local users to cause a denial of service (panic) via unknown vectors related to the "/proc" filesystem, which trigger a null dereference. | Solaris | N/A | ||
2005-10-14 | CVE-2005-3238 | Multiple unspecified vulnerabilities in Solaris 10 SCTP Socket Option Processing allows local users to cause a denial of service (panic) via unspecified attack vectors. | Solaris | N/A | ||
2005-09-28 | CVE-2005-3099 | Unspecified vulnerability in the (1) Xsun and (2) Xprt commands in Solaris 7, 8, 9, and 10 allows local users to execute arbitrary code. | Solaris, Sunos | N/A | ||
2005-09-27 | CVE-2005-3071 | Unspecified vulnerability in Unix File System (UFS) on Solaris 8 and 9, when logging is enabled, allows local users to cause a denial of service ("soft hang") via certain write operations to UFS. | Solaris, Sunos | N/A | ||
2005-09-20 | CVE-2005-3001 | Unspecified vulnerability in the "tl" driver in Solaris 10 allows local users to cause a denial of service (panic) via unknown vectors. | Solaris | N/A |
